Lungile Radu looking forward to hosting Big Brother SA
source: sowetanlive, by Bongiwe Sithole
TV presenter and actor Lungile Radu has been announced as the official host for reality show Big Brother Mzansi where South Africans will be competing for a whopping prize of R1 million.
The show that airs February 2 at 19:00 will be screened live 24/7 on channels 197 and 198 to DStv Premium and Compact audiences.
Radu will be the only contact that contestants will get to interact with for the period they in the show. His role as the host will be to keep viewers updated about the show and who will be exiting the house.
The show will be no different to Big Brother Africa except it being exclusive to South Africans only.
However few details regarding the number of contestants and how long they will be staying in the house are known.
“Contestants are part of the big reveal, and due to the nature and format of the show will only be revealed on the day when the show goes LIVE,” says M- Net spokesperson Nomphelo Nzimande.
Radu is thrilled to be presenting another big show after Fear Factor and wants to use this platform to learn more and better his skills as a host.
“This does not only appeal to me as the presenter but also the producer in me. It will also give me the chance to hone my live presenting skills.
Being on-air in real time is one of the most challenging aspects of TV presenting and there’s no better place to master that skill than on a program where unpredictable characters, shocking twists and unexpected turns are in fact, normal,” he says.
Commenting on Radu’s appointment as presenter for Big Brother Mzansi, M-Net Director for Local Interest Channels Yolisa Phahle says he was a natural choice suitable to his experience.
